Summer survey finds river otters continue to thrive on the Yampa River after successful reintroduction

The early 1900s weren't a good time to be a river otter in the state of Colorado. In 1906, the last known otter in the state was trapped on the lower Yampa River, and the species was declared extinct here. US Fiancee of IS Fighter Pleads Guilty to Terror Charges

The Internet fiancee of an alleged Islamic State fighter pleaded guilty to terrorism charges in the United States on Wednesday. Nineteen-year-old Shannon Conley of Arvada, Colorado admitted to the court that she trained to aid jihadists in Syria, including the man she met online. The teenager, who is a Muslim convert, attended a military-style training camp in the U.S., learned to shoot guns ...

Beware: Taxes in retirement

Taxes are likely to be one of your biggest bills in retirement, especially if you have done most of your saving in tax-deferred retirement accounts. But where you live plays a big role in the tax rate you pay on your retirement income.

Medical pot program combines medicine and research

ST. PAUL, Minn. (AP) - Minnesota's new medical marijuana program doesn't stop at the sales counter. The state will gather data from each and every patient on different chemical compounds, dosages and side effects to build a database of what works - and what doesn't. Lawmakers included the ...
